In August 2025, Professor Carolyn Hoyle, Director of the Death Penalty Research Unit (DPRU), and Parvais Jabbar, Co-Executive Director of the DPRU's partner organisation the Death Penalty Project (DPP), published a new academic article on the abolition of the death penalty in Zimbabwe in the Journal of Human Rights Practice.

Carolyn and Parvais' article reflects on the process leading up to Zimbabwe's abolition in December 2024, which involved legal strategy, capacity building for stakeholders, empirical research and high-level dialogue and advocacy, in collaboration with partners including diplomats, local lawyers, politicians and civil society organisations.

The article, titled 'Abolishing the Death Penalty in Zimbabwe: Building a Platform to Promote Policy Reform', is now available to read on an open-access basis through the Journal of Human Rights Practice, and will be included in the print edition of the journal which is forthcoming in November 2025.
